		<description><![CDATA[TheFanboyReview.com is reporting that one of the home video releases of Dragonball: Evolution will be coming out with the title &#8220;Z-Edition&#8221; tacked on. What this means is anyone&#8217;s guess, but extended and deleted scenes are likely. The DVD and Blu-Ray are expected to drop in the summer.
